2013 HTG to CLP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2013

During 2013, the HTG to CLP ex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on December 4, valuing the pair at 13.7186.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on February 25, dropping to 10.9879.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 2.7306 CLP.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 11.2244 to the December average rate of 13.0592, the exchange rate registered a net change of 16.35% (reflecting a strengthening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2013 high of 13.7186 was up 6.48% compared to the 2012 peak of 12.8836,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.
